WebHow to enable, start, and disable services using systemctl in Linux WebMar 5, 2024 · Chrony is both NTP server and client software. Therefore, install the same Chrony NTP software on your client machine. # dnf install -y chrony. Edit Chrony configuration file with the help of vim text editor. # vi /etc/chrony.conf. Find and comment the line that starts with "pool" directive. Add following line in this file.
